A RSS-BJP worker was hacked to death by unidentified assailants near Payyannur in Kerala's Kannur district on Friday, May 11.

The deceased has been identified as Biju, a Kakkampara Mandal Karyavahak of RSS. According to police, he was travelling on his bike when he was attacked at around 3 pm. He died on the spot. The attackers were in a car.

Police are suspecting that as Biju was the 12th accused in the murder of CPI (M) worker Dhanraj, his murder may be an act of vengeance by the rival party.

According to Manaroma, Biju was under police protection till last week. "As of now we have no clue about who is behind the attack. But we believe that his political rivals may have murdered him," said a police officer.

Meanwhile, BJP are alleging that CPI (M) conspired and executed the murder. BJP has also called for a strike in Kannur on Saturday. Security has been tightened in the area to avoid any clash between BJP and CPI (M).

In July 2016, CPI (M) activist Dhanraj was hacked to death outside his home in Payyanur. The activist was attacked when he was about to enter his house at around 10.30 pm. Later that night, BMS (labour wing of RSS) worker CK Ramachandran was also hacked to death in retaliation to Dhnaraj's murder.
